Step 1: Gather Required Documents

  • Proof of citizenship, such as a birth certificate or naturalization certificate.
  • Government-issued photo ID, such as a driver’s license.
  • Two recent passport photos that meet the requirements set by the U.S. Department of State.
  • Passport application form DS-11, which can be filled out online or printed and completed by hand.
  • Payment for the application fee which is $145 for adults (16 years and older) and $115 for children (15 years and younger).

Make sure you have all the required documents before you start the application process to avoid any delays.

Step 2: Fill Out the Application Form

You can fill out the passport application form online and print it, or you can print it and complete it by hand. Make sure to fill out all the required fields accurately and completely. If you make a mistake, use the correction fluid to make the correction, and if it is a major mistake, then you will have to fill out a new form. Do not sign the application form until you are asked to do so by the passport acceptance agent.

Step 3: Get a Passport Photo

Passport photos are not like regular photos; they need to meet certain requirements. They should be 2 inches x 2 inches, taken within the last 6 months, and on a plain white or off-white background. You can get your passport photo taken at many retail stores, drugstores, or post offices. Be sure to bring the required photo identification when getting your photo taken.

Step 4: Pay the Application Fee

The application fee for a new adult passport is $145, and for children under 16 years old, it is $115. There is also an extra fee if you want expedited processing, which is an additional $60. You can pay with a personal check or money order made out to “U.S. Department of State” or by credit card.

Step 5: Submit Your Application

After completing the application form, getting your passport photo taken, and paying the application fee, you need to submit your application. You can do this in person at a U.S. Department of State Passport Agency, Passport Acceptance Facility, or U.S. Embassy or Consulate. You can also apply through a regional passport agency if you need your passport urgently.
